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
841 743 344147918 0663056315
70205569321 67 894343
70205569321 67 894343
3677 431083136 62
All about undefined
Interested in learning more?
70205569321 67 894343
3677 431083136 62
See more
8879722691 296469743 63158
147964066 1548542611 14 3266990 11629
See more
36 20
031 80792 462361 09
See more